Barney View then and now
Side-by-side ABS Census comparison for Barney View, QLD (postcode 4287) — how the suburb looked across Census years from 2011 to 2021.
Population
Census 2011 → 2016 → 2021
-44.1% over 10 years
| Metric | 2011 | 2016 | 2021 | Change (→2021) |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 68 | 64 | 38 | -30 · -44.1% |
| Median age | 48 | 54 | 59 | +11 · +22.9% |
| Median household income | $844/wk | $833/wk | $1,042/wk | +$198 · +23.5% |
| Median personal income | $406/wk | $575/wk | $599/wk | +$193 · +47.5% |
| Median rent | $200/wk | $160/wk | $200/wk | $0 · 0% |
| Median mortgage | $1,387/mo | — | $2,434/mo | +$1,047 · +75.5% |
| Average household size | 2.4 | 2.0 | 1.9 | -0.5 · -20.8% |
Change is measured from the earliest available Census year to 2021 for each metric.
